How should Christians receive spiritual food?

Answered in 1 source

Christians should receive spiritual food by actively engaging with Scripture, partaking in the Lord's Supper, and gathering for worship.

Receiving spiritual food is crucial for every believer’s growth in faith. The ministry of the Word, both through the preaching of Scripture and personal study, acts as nourishment for the soul. As indicated in 1 Peter 2:2, believers are encouraged to 'desire the sincere milk of the word,' which implies a hunger for teaching that fosters spiritual growth. Furthermore, participation in the Lord's Supper serves as a vital reminder of Christ’s sacrifice and provides a means for believers to spiritually partake of His body and blood, acknowledging their need for continual sustenance through Him.

Moreover, regular attendance at corporate worship and fellowship with other believers enhances one’s reception of spiritual food. Just as individuals require physical nourishment to thrive, spiritual generosity is obtained through communal gatherings where Scripture is preached, prayers are made, and worship is shared. This community aspect reinforces the requirement for believers to be actively engaged, allowing for mutual edification as they grow in their faith together.
